This sale offering is an approximately 19.29-acre mining claim and land parcel in Melrose, Montana. The property’s setting includes BLM land on three sides, with Soap Gulch Creek running through the bottom of the claim. The layout allows for use both on lower ground near the creek and higher ground, with room to consider a small hunting cabin placement on or near the property features.
Access is available via a good road leading to the site. The location is described as being about 5 miles from the Big Hole River, which is noted for fishing in the state. The property also supports convenient hunting logistics, with BLM hunting access described as right out your door.
For buyers looking for recreational land tied to hunting and creekside use, this parcel provides a self-contained base with surrounding BLM acreage that can extend available hunting opportunities. For those exploring mining-claim ownership alongside outdoor recreation, the combination of creek access, BLM adjacency, and road access makes it a straightforward option to evaluate for a cabin or private retreat concept.
